FeaturePeek logo FeaturePeek

Collaborate on in-progress website implementations. FeaturePeek allows your team to collect feedback on your front-end during the implementation phase of development.

Sifter logo Sifter

Sifter is designed to be a simple bug and issue tracker for small teams and works especially great for teams with non-technical folks involved.

Sifter Reviews

Top 17 Best Bug Tracking Tools: an overview 19 Jun 2017
Sifter is a bug-tracking tool geared towards (smaller) teams that are less tech savvy. Similar to FogBugz, users can sort issues based on different milestones within the project. Although screenshots cannot be made using this tool, logging issues and updating your team on the status of said issues is quite simple. Website: www.sifterapp.com
